This command spawns the specified location instance. If you don't specify "SAVE" at the end of the command, it will permanently disable world saving. See all codes on our location ID list.
Cheat
location < Location ID > < SAVE >
This command spawns the specified amount of items or characters. See our item ID list and character ID list for entity IDs. Level only affects characters. Using a level higher than 10 can cause the game to crash upon their death, due to the amount of item drops.
Cheat
spawn < Entity ID > < Amount > < Level >

This command gives your character a specified premade item set. Without the use of the "keep" argument, all of your current inventory items will be dropped. Item sets are (without quotes): "Meadows" (skills set to one, wood and flint weapons, bronze pickaxe), "BlackForest" (skills set to 10, wood and flint weapons), "Swamps" (skills set to a number between 10 and 20, bronze weapons, bronze armor), "Mountains" (skills set to 25, iron weapons, iron armor), "Plains" (skills set to 35, silver weapons, wolf armor), "PlainsBoss" (skills set to 40, blackmetal weapons, padded armor), "EndGame" (skills set to 70, upgraded blackmetal weapons, padded armor).
Cheat
itemset < Name > < keep >

This command changes the rate at which time passes. The fastest value time can pass at is 3, and using a value of 0 will pause time.
Cheat
timescale < Multiplier > < Fade Time >
This command sets the time of day, with values 0 and 1 both being midnight. Using the value of -1 will change back to default time.
Cheat
tod < 0 - 1 >
This command sets the speed and direction of the wind. The angle value must be between 0 and 360, with 0 blowing North, and intensity being between 0 and 1.
Cheat
wind < Angle (0 - 360) > < Intensity >
